Course Title
Intro to Interpreting Profession
Description
The course provides students with an introduction to the profession of sign language interpreting. Content covered includes a global history of the profession (organizations, credentialing, philosophical and ethical roles, and models of interpreting) and current or emerging trends in the field. Additionally, techniques on interpreting processing and cognitive skills will be introduced. Moreover, frameworks for critically analyzing how service providers (interpreters, educators, etc.) un/consciously contribute to dis/empowerment, dis/ability, and in/access in the deaf community.
